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Romford to Pangbourne start from £30.30 one way, or £30.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Romford to Pangbourne are available for £46.50 one way, or £61.40 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Romford Station

The ticket office at Romford operates with convenient hours throughout the week, opening as early as 6 AM on weekdays and slightly later on weekends. With readily available ticket machines located in the station's main hall, grabbing your ticket for an exciting day out couldn't be easier.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access to all platforms, making it a commuter-friendly hub for everyone.

While there’s no waiting room, you can take advantage of sheltered seating options spread across platforms 1, 2, 4, and 5. Romford also ensures a seamless travel experience by offering various support services like customer help points and induction loops for the hearing impaired. Don’t forget to stay connected with public Wi-Fi available throughout the station. Though there's no luggage storage, the station is well-equipped with CCTV to ensure safety and security during your visit.

Facilities at Pangbourne Train Station

Pangbourne Station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. For those purchasing tickets, there is a ticket office available from 06:20 to 12:50 on weekdays and from 07:00 to 13:30 on Saturdays. Ticket machines are also accessible, making the collection of online-purchased tickets a breeze. The station prides itself on its accessible amenities, including clearly marked step-free paths to certain platforms. However, it is essential to note that not all areas are fully accessible, so it's advisable to plan ahead if mobility is a concern.

For those needing assistance, customer help points are strategically placed around the station. CCTV cameras ensure security, and the public Wi-Fi network keeps you connected while you wait. Unfortunately, the station lacks certain conveniences such as refreshment facilities and ATMs, so plan to arrive prepared.
